Zullo’s Paradox

Zullo’s paradox is a result of the Theory of Special Relativity applied to an investigation.

Zullo is basically saying that he cannot release the results of the Cold Case Posse investigation because it’s not finished. It’s not finished because in the course of the investigation, new things are found to investigate.

It’s like a particle approaching the speed of light. The faster the particle goes, the more energy is required to accelerate it. The amount of energy required to actually reach the speed of light is infinite. In the same way the amount of investigation required to reach the release of information is also infinite because the more Zullo investigates, the more he discovers to investigate.

Zullo’s paradox relates to the well-known principle that a conspiracy theory grows to account for new evidence contradicting the theory. Therefore, it would take an infinite amount of evidence to counter a conspiracy theory.
